As the leader of the Terumo Blood and Cell Technology (TBCT) Extrusion Vertical Integration Program, you'll drive innovation in medical device plastic processing. In this high-impact role, you'll oversee tubing extrusion, plastic compounding, and supplier qualifications while coll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ance quality, efficiency, and performance. With a strong focus on technical leadership, strategic planning, and regulatory compliance, this position offers the opportunity to shape global processes and mentor engineering teams. If you're an expert in medical device plastics with a passion for innovation and leadership, we invite you to bring your expertise to our dynamic and growing team in Lakewood, Colorado.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Lead the TBCT Extrusion Vertical Integration Program, ensuring tubing quality, cost efficiency, and production rates align with demand.
  • Serve as a Subject Matter Expert in plastic processing, collaborating with cross-functional teams to optimize performance.
  • Develop and implement strategies to enhance tubing extrusion and plastics processing.
  • Support the qualification of external suppliers for tubing extrusion, film production, and plastic compounding.
  • Oversee engineering standards for tubing extrusion, film production, and plastic compounding.
  • Provide technical leadership to extrusion process engineers during process development phases.
  • Manages and provides leadership for the functional group's development, direction, and effectiveness, adhering to organizational policies and processes and supporting overall business and corporate objectives.
  • Participates in the short and long term planning process that establishes technical objectives for a business unit project or functional engineering group.
  • Utilizes technical, managerial expertise and creativity to evaluate proposed solutions, adaptations, and modifications to projects and products used globally.
  • Identifies project, product opportunities and initiates prioritization in addition to implementation.
  • Completes annual department budgeting and accountable for long range planning.
  • Implements and understands FDA or global regulatory requirements as necessary.
  • Ensures compliance with company Quality System regulations and safe working practices.

  • Terumo Blood and Cell Technologies is part of Terumo Group, founded in 1921 and head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
  • In 2024, Terumo Blood and Cell Technologies reached $1.5 billion in revenue.
  • We employ nearly 8,000 associates globally, with global headquarters in Lakewood, CO, U.S., and regional headquarters in Brussels, Buenos Aires, Singapore and Tokyo.
  • We manufacture devices, disposable sets and solutions at our facilities in Belgium, India, Japan, Northern Ireland, the U.S. and Vietnam. Our global presence enables us to serve customers in more than 130 countries.
